Observations

We experienced widespread wind effect on the wind exposed West and Southwest aspects of Jug Saturday. Ski conditions were still very good in protected areas. We experienced some isolated cracking while skiing and skinning as well 6-8-inch-deep failures with very gentle pressure in mitt pits and ski cuts on the softer snow below the wind affected snow. Of major note was that there were no recent avalanches or debris on the East and Northeast slopes we saw from the summit ridge. The cornices had grown considerably since earlier in the week, see photo. I would be interested to know if anything popped loose anywhere after the Saturday evening earthquake.
